Since you expressed interest in the Canadian HCCA tour, I presume your T is a pre-1916. If so, you might be interested in the week-long Snappers tour in Ithaca, NY the following week.

Snappers is a non-geographical brass-era touring region of AACA. It puts on several tours a year. I'm planning on going to both the Canadian tour and the Snappers tour.

Matt, What Mike Vaughn says above that a Chapter or someone has to step up and volunteer to host a tour is correct. Do you belong to an MTFCA Chapter, and could you get that Chapter to do a tour?

Besides a National Tour, there are several regional tours put on by various club chapters and some just put on by smaller groups of individuals. The Mainly T Tour is an example & they put it on every year.

Check around and I wouldn't be surprised if you do find a tour in your area.
